Arch Linux (Rolling)
Arch Linux: um sistema operacional poderoso, personalizável e de lançamento contínuo para usuários avançados.
Informações básicas
O Arch Linux é uma distribuição GNU/Linux de propósito geral, desenvolvida de forma independente. Ele opera em um modelo de lançamento contínuo (rolling release), o que significa que não há "versões" distintas ou ciclos de lançamento fixos; em vez disso, fornece atualizações contínuas, garantindo que o sistema sempre execute o software estável mais recente. As mídias de instalação são lançadas mensalmente como snapshots, como o 2025.11.01, contendo o kernel e os pacotes básicos mais recentes. O lançamento inicial do Arch Linux ocorreu em 11 de março de 2002.
- Modelo/Versão: Rolling Release (ex: último snapshot ISO 2025.11.01)
- Data de lançamento: 11 de março de 2002 (lançamento inicial)
- Requisitos mínimos: Consulte a seção de Requisitos Técnicos.
- Sistemas Operacionais Suportados: Não aplicável (trata-se de um sistema operacional).
- Última versão estável: Atualizada continuamente através do modelo de lançamento contínuo.
- Data de fim do suporte: Não aplicável (o modelo de lançamento contínuo fornece atualizações constantes).
- Data de Fim da Vida Útil: Não aplicável (o modelo de lançamento contínuo fornece atualizações constantes).
- Data de expiração da atualização automática: Não aplicável (as atualizações são contínuas e gerenciadas pelo usuário).
- Tipo de licença: Software livre, principalmente sob a licença GNU GPL e outras licenças de código aberto. A distribuição em si é uma coleção de pacotes de software com licenças independentes.
- Modelo de implantação: Instalação em hardware dedicado, máquinas virtuais e contêineres (por exemplo, Docker, Proxmox VE LXC).
Requisitos técnicos
O Arch Linux foi projetado para minimalismo e personalização pelo usuário, resultando em requisitos de sistema básicos bastante modestos. O consumo real de recursos depende muito do ambiente de desktop escolhido pelo usuário e dos aplicativos instalados.
- RAM: Mínimo de 512 MB; recomenda-se 2 GB para uma experiência mais fluida, especialmente com interface gráfica de usuário.
- Processador: CPU compatível com x86-64. O suporte para a arquitetura i686 (32 bits) terminou oficialmente em 2017.
- Armazenamento: Uma instalação básica requer menos de 2 GB de espaço em disco. Para um sistema com interface gráfica e uso geral, recomenda-se 20 GB.
- Tela: Não há requisitos específicos de tela para o sistema básico. Os ambientes gráficos determinarão as necessidades de tela.
- Portas: Uma conexão de internet funcional é essencial para a instalação e o gerenciamento contínuo do pacote.
- Sistema Operacional: Não aplicável (é um sistema operacional).
Análise: Os requisitos técnicos do Arch Linux são notavelmente baixos para seu sistema base, aderindo à sua filosofia "Keep It Simple, Stupid" (KISS). Isso permite que os usuários criem um sistema altamente eficiente, adaptado precisamente às suas necessidades de hardware e software, evitando excessos desnecessários. A principal limitação é a arquitetura x86-64, com forks mantidos pela comunidade que atendem aos sistemas mais antigos de 32 bits e ARM. A flexibilidade na alocação de recursos significa que, embora os requisitos mínimos sejam baixos, o uso prático com ambientes de desktop modernos exigirá hardware mais robusto, principalmente RAM e armazenamento.
Suporte e compatibilidade
O modelo de lançamento contínuo do Arch Linux garante acesso constante às versões mais recentes do software e às atualizações do kernel, impactando diretamente a compatibilidade e o suporte.
- Última versão: Lançamento contínuo, o que significa que o sistema está sempre atualizado com os pacotes de software estáveis mais recentes.
- Suporte a sistemas operacionais: Visa principalmente a arquitetura x86-64. Projetos da comunidade, como o Arch Linux 32 e o Arch Linux ARM, oferecem suporte para i686 e diversos dispositivos ARM, respectivamente.
- Data de Fim do Suporte: Não aplicável; atualizações contínuas anulam as datas tradicionais de fim de suporte.
- Localização: Estão disponíveis diversas opções de localização, que podem ser configuradas pelo usuário.
- Drivers disponíveis: Os drivers estão integrados principalmente ao kernel do Linux ou disponíveis em repositórios oficiais e no Arch User Repository (AUR). Os usuários são responsáveis por instalar e configurar os drivers de hardware específicos conforme necessário.
Análise: O Arch Linux se destaca por fornecer software atualizado e ampla compatibilidade de hardware por meio de seu modelo de distribuição contínua (rolling release). Isso garante que os usuários sempre tenham acesso ao kernel e aos drivers mais recentes. No entanto, sua natureza "faça você mesmo" coloca a responsabilidade pela configuração do sistema, incluindo o gerenciamento de drivers e a configuração de localização, diretamente sobre o usuário. A abrangente ArchWiki e uma comunidade ativa servem como principais recursos de suporte, oferecendo documentação detalhada e assistência entre usuários.
Estado de segurança
O Arch Linux enfatiza a segurança por meio de seus princípios de design, embora sua eficácia dependa em grande parte da implementação e da vigilância do usuário.
- Recursos de segurança: As atualizações contínuas garantem a entrega imediata dos patches de segurança mais recentes. O sistema base minimalista reduz a superfície de ataque, incluindo apenas os componentes essenciais. O gerenciador de pacotes Pacman verifica a integridade dos pacotes usando assinaturas GPG e checksums para evitar adulterações.
- Vulnerabilidades conhecidas: Devido à sua natureza de lançamento contínuo, as vulnerabilidades são normalmente corrigidas e solucionadas rapidamente. Os usuários devem aplicar as atualizações regularmente para mitigar os riscos.
- Status na lista negra: Não aplicável.
- Certificações: Normalmente, não existem certificações de segurança específicas associadas ao Arch Linux.
- Suporte à criptografia: Suporta criptografia de disco completo (FDE), criptografia do sistema de arquivos e partições de swap criptografadas. Esses recursos são altamente recomendados para proteção de dados.
- Métodos de autenticação: Os mecanismos de autenticação padrão do Linux são suportados, incluindo políticas de senhas fortes, chaves SSH para acesso remoto e a capacidade de desativar o login direto do usuário root via SSH.
- Recomendações gerais: Recomenda-se aos usuários que mantenham seus sistemas atualizados, usem senhas fortes e exclusivas, habilitem a criptografia completa do disco, configurem firewalls (por exemplo, ufw ou iptables), implementem controle de acesso obrigatório (por exemplo, SELinux ou AppArmor) e tomem precauções ao usar pacotes do Arch User Repository (AUR), revisando os arquivos PKGBUILD.
Análise: O Arch Linux oferece uma base sólida para um sistema seguro devido à sua instalação mínima e ciclo de atualização rápido. No entanto, ele não impõe muitas configurações de segurança por padrão, dependendo do usuário para implementar medidas de reforço. Essa abordagem centrada no usuário significa que a classificação geral de segurança depende muito do conhecimento e da diligência do usuário na configuração e manutenção do sistema. Para usuários experientes, o Arch pode ser configurado para ser muito seguro.
Desempenho e indicadores de desempenho
O Arch Linux é conhecido por seu desempenho, em grande parte atribuído ao seu design minimalista e à personalização orientada pelo usuário.
- Resultados dos testes de desempenho: Os resultados específicos dos testes de desempenho variam bastante, pois o desempenho depende muito do hardware do usuário, do ambiente de desktop escolhido e dos softwares instalados. O sistema em si é extremamente leve.
- Métricas de desempenho no mundo real: Os usuários frequentemente relatam alta capacidade de resposta e velocidade. A ausência de serviços em segundo plano desnecessários e de softwares pré-instalados desnecessários contribui para a utilização eficiente de recursos e tempos de inicialização mais rápidos.
- Consumo de energia: Geralmente baixo e altamente configurável. Ao selecionar componentes leves e otimizar os serviços, os usuários podem obter excelente eficiência energética, tornando-o adequado para laptops e sistemas embarcados.
- Pegada de carbono: Mínima, devido à baixa sobrecarga de recursos e à operação eficiente. Isso se deve principalmente à eficiência do hardware e à configuração do usuário.
- Comparação com sistemas similares: O Arch Linux é frequentemente citado por oferecer desempenho superior em comparação com muitas outras distribuições, principalmente aquelas com mais softwares pré-configurados e ambientes de desktop padrão mais pesados (como Ubuntu e Fedora). Seu modelo de lançamento contínuo (rolling release) também garante acesso mais rápido a atualizações de kernel e software que melhoram o desempenho.
Análise: O Arch Linux oferece uma plataforma excepcional para usuários focados em desempenho. Sua filosofia de "monte o seu próprio sistema" permite a criação de um sistema altamente otimizado, livre de processos e softwares desnecessários. Isso resulta em um ambiente operacional enxuto, rápido e eficiente. Embora não existam benchmarks prontos para uso devido à sua natureza personalizável, o consenso entre os usuários é que o Arch Linux oferece excelente desempenho no mundo real.
Avaliações e comentários dos usuários
As avaliações e comentários dos usuários destacam consistentemente o Arch Linux como uma distribuição poderosa, porém exigente, mais adequada para perfis de usuário específicos.
- Pontos fortes: Os usuários elogiam o Arch Linux por sua incomparável capacidade de personalização e controle, permitindo que construam um sistema exatamente de acordo com suas especificações. O modelo de lançamento contínuo garante acesso aos softwares e recursos mais recentes ("de ponta"). O gerenciador de pacotes Pacman é conhecido por sua velocidade e eficiência, e o Arch User Repository (AUR) oferece uma vasta coleção de softwares mantidos pela comunidade. A ArchWiki é universalmente aclamada como um recurso extenso e inestimável para documentação e solução de problemas. Muitos usuários também apreciam a experiência de aprendizado que ela proporciona.
- Pontos fracos: A principal desvantagem é a sua curva de aprendizado acentuada e o complexo processo de instalação baseado em linha de comando, o que o torna inadequado para iniciantes. Usuários relatam que ele exige tempo e esforço consideráveis para a configuração inicial e a manutenção contínua. Embora geralmente estável, o modelo de lançamento contínuo pode ocasionalmente levar a problemas se as atualizações não forem gerenciadas com cuidado ou se muitos pacotes AUR forem utilizados.
- Casos de uso recomendados: O Arch Linux é altamente recomendado para usuários experientes de Linux, desenvolvedores, usuários avançados e entusiastas de tecnologia que desejam o máximo controle, flexibilidade e os softwares mais recentes. É ideal para quem gosta de explorar, aprender as complexidades do sistema e construir um ambiente altamente otimizado do zero. Não é recomendado para usuários que buscam uma experiência pronta para uso imediato ou para aqueles que não desejam investir tempo na configuração e manutenção do sistema.
Resumo
O Arch Linux é uma distribuição GNU/Linux única e poderosa, caracterizada por seu modelo de lançamento contínuo (rolling release), design minimalista e filosofia centrada no usuário. Oferece controle e flexibilidade incomparáveis, permitindo que os usuários construam um ambiente operacional altamente personalizado e eficiente a partir de um sistema base mínimo. Seus principais pontos fortes incluem acesso contínuo aos softwares mais recentes, um gerenciador de pacotes rápido (Pacman), o extenso Repositório de Usuários do Arch (AUR) e a abrangente ArchWiki, que serve como um recurso vital para a comunidade. O desempenho é geralmente excelente devido à ausência de excesso de recursos desnecessários e à capacidade de adaptar o sistema precisamente ao hardware. A segurança, embora robusta em sua base, depende muito da configuração e manutenção proativas do usuário.
No entanto, o Arch Linux não está isento de desafios. Sua instalação via linha de comando e a abordagem "faça você mesmo" apresentam uma curva de aprendizado acentuada, tornando-o inadequado para iniciantes. Exige um investimento significativo de tempo e conhecimento para a configuração inicial e o gerenciamento contínuo, já que os usuários são responsáveis por configurar praticamente todos os aspectos do sistema. Embora geralmente estável, a natureza de lançamento contínuo (rolling release) significa que intervenções manuais ocasionais podem ser necessárias, e o gerenciamento inadequado de atualizações ou pacotes AUR pode levar à instabilidade do sistema.
Recomendações: O Arch Linux é uma excelente escolha para usuários experientes de Linux, desenvolvedores e usuários avançados que valorizam controle total, software de ponta e um profundo conhecimento do sistema operacional. É ideal para quem aprecia o processo de construir e manter um sistema altamente otimizado e personalizado. Para usuários que buscam uma experiência pronta para uso e com baixa manutenção, ou para aqueles que são novos no Linux, outras distribuições podem ser mais apropriadas. Os benefícios de usar o Arch Linux, em termos de desempenho, flexibilidade e aprendizado, são substanciais para aqueles dispostos a abraçar sua filosofia exigente, porém enriquecedora.
Nota: As informações fornecidas são baseadas em dados disponíveis publicamente e podem variar dependendo das configurações específicas do dispositivo. Para obter informações atualizadas, consulte os recursos oficiais do fabricante.
